相关疑难解决方法(0)

在Eclipse中设置JDK

我有两个JDK,用于Java 6和7.

我想用两者构建我的项目.最初我们只针对1.6构建.我在项目设置中看到我可以选择1.5,1.6 1.7作为编译器级别.

如何将这些选项添加到IDE中?我从未安装过Java 1.5.假设我想要Java 1.4.如何让它出现在列表中?我在IDE首选项中添加了两个不同的JRE,但这些不是下拉列表中显示的内容.

java eclipse

102
推荐指数
4
解决办法
46万
查看次数

(Spring Boot 和 H2) 不能使用 h2 数据库

我正在学习 Spring Boot,我正在尝试创建一个非常简单的 RESTful API,它可以访问内存数据库并执行 CRUD 操作。

但是,每次我尝试在http://localhost:8080/h2-console上连接或测试连接时,我都会收到此错误:

“未找到数据库“C:/Users/XXX/test”,并且 IFEXISTS=true,因此我们无法自动创建它 [90146-199] 90146/90146”

https://imgur.com/a/oYgkK1C

我完全按照http://www.springboottutorial.com/spring-boot-crud-rest-service-with-jpa-hibernate的说明进行操作。我已经尝试了我可以在网上找到的所有内容:使用 jdbc:h2:mem:test 作为 JDBC URL 等,但它们都没有为我工作,我不确定我做错了什么。我没有从官方网站安装h2数据库,因为我读到它没有必要使用内存模块(我仍然不知道我是否应该安装它,因为没有提到据我检查,它是在线的)。

有什么想法吗?我是 Spring Boot 的初学者,我真的很迷茫。我只想测试 CRUD 操作,而不关心数据库的持久性。

我在下面提供了我的 application.properties。

谢谢!:)

# H2
spring.h2.console.enabled=true
spring.h2.console.path=/h2

# Datasource
spring.datasource.url=jdbc:h2:mem:test
spring.datasource.username=user
spring.datasource.password=user
spring.datasource.driver-class-name=org.h2.Driver
Run Code Online (Sandbox Code Playgroud)

h2 spring-boot

0
推荐指数
1
解决办法
3544
查看次数

标签 统计

eclipse ×1

h2 ×1

java ×1

spring-boot ×1